]> git.scottworley.com Git - reliable-chat/blobdiff - server/server.go
Merge skitch's changes.
[reliable-chat] / server / server.go
index 5c5ef50fbfd448989c3b57648f466e76ede087fa..9ca5e619c1a9d18cd53981af2157458e7caa5cac 100644 (file)
@@ -11,6 +11,7 @@ import "time"
 
 var port = flag.Int("port", 21059, "Port to listen on")
 
+var frame_count = expvar.NewInt("frame_count")
 var speak_count = expvar.NewInt("speak_count")
 var fetch_count = expvar.NewInt("fetch_count")
 var fetch_wait_count = expvar.NewInt("fetch_wait_count")
@@ -160,6 +161,7 @@ func start_server(store Store) {
                        return
                }
                w.Header().Add("Content-Type", "application/json")
+               w.Header().Add("Access-Control-Allow-Origin", "*")
                w.Write(json_encoded)
        })
 
@@ -171,6 +173,7 @@ func start_server(store Store) {
        })
 
        http.HandleFunc("/frame", func(w http.ResponseWriter, r *http.Request) {
+               frame_count.Add(1)
                w.Write([]byte(frame_html));
        })
 
@@ -178,6 +181,7 @@ func start_server(store Store) {
 }
 
 func main() {
+       flag.Parse()
        store := start_store()
        start_server(store)
 }